Austria, Empire. An Order of the Iron Crown, II. Class with War Decoration, by Rothe & Neffe, c.1970 GTRexclude 2 mm (w) x 51(Orden der Eisernen Krone). Instituted January 1st, 1816. (c. 1970 issue). A very fine quality example of this award, constructed of gilded bronze and multi coloured enamels, consisting of the Lombard Iron Crown presenting green, red and white enamelled jewels, on which rests the two headed Austrian eagle with sword and orb, with a blue enamelled central shield showing on the obverse the imperial initial F and on the reverse the year 1815, dual green
